AMD Ryzen终极调试工具完全指南:从新手到高手

张开发
2026/6/10 18:28:02 15 分钟阅读
AMD Ryzen终极调试工具完全指南:从新手到高手
AMD Ryzen终极调试工具完全指南从新手到高手【免费下载链接】SMUDebugToolA dedicated tool to help write/read various parameters of Ryzen-based systems, such as manual overclock, SMU, PCI, CPUID, MSR and Power Table.项目地址: https://gitcode.com/gh_mirrors/smu/SMUDebugToolSMUDebugTool是一款专为AMD Ryzen系统设计的开源调试工具让你能够深度访问和控制处理器的核心参数。想象一下当你的Ryzen系统遇到性能瓶颈、稳定性问题或启动故障时这款工具就像一把瑞士军刀为你提供从硬件底层到系统层面的全面调试能力。无论你是硬件爱好者、系统管理员还是游戏玩家掌握SMUDebugTool的使用都能让你的Ryzen系统发挥出最佳性能。为什么你需要专业的Ryzen调试工具现代AMD处理器拥有复杂的硬件架构包括SMU系统管理单元、PCIe配置、MSR寄存器等关键组件。当系统出现问题时传统的软件诊断工具往往只能触及表面而SMUDebugTool却能深入到硬件底层让你真正掌控系统的每一个细节。想象这样一个场景你的Ryzen 9 5900X在运行大型游戏时频繁蓝屏温度监控正常但系统就是不稳定。普通用户可能会束手无策但有了SMUDebugTool你可以直接检查每个核心的电压稳定性调整PBO参数甚至修复SMU固件状态。SMUDebugTool的核心电压调节界面显示16核心的电压控制滑块和NUMA节点信息场景一解决游戏卡顿与系统崩溃问题问题场景高负载下系统不稳定你在玩最新的3A游戏时系统突然卡顿几秒然后恢复正常或者更糟——直接蓝屏重启。这种情况往往与CPU电压不稳定有关特别是在多核心同时高负载运行时。核心原理电压稳定性与性能平衡每个CPU核心都有独立的电压调节机制当电压波动超过安全范围时就会导致计算错误和系统崩溃。SMUDebugTool让你能够精确监控和调整每个核心的电压找到性能与稳定性的最佳平衡点。解决方案精准电压调整操作步骤具体操作预期结果注意事项1. 启动工具以管理员身份运行SMUDebugTool工具主界面正常打开确保有管理员权限2. 监控电压切换到CPU标签页启动实时监控看到各核心电压实时变化设置采样间隔为100ms3. 压力测试运行游戏或压力测试软件CPU负载达到80%以上观察电压波动情况4. 识别问题找到电压波动最大的核心确定需要调整的核心编号记录波动幅度5. 微调电压对问题核心进行±10mV调整电压波动控制在±3%以内每次调整后测试稳定性6. 保存配置点击Save保存优化设置配置文件保存成功命名要有意义提示电压调整要循序渐进每次调整后至少运行15分钟压力测试确保系统稳定。实战案例Ryzen 7 5800X游戏优化一位用户发现他的5800X在玩《赛博朋克2077》时频繁崩溃。使用SMUDebugTool后发现核心7和核心11的电压在高负载下波动达到±8%。通过以下优化步骤解决了问题将核心7电压增加15mV将核心11电压增加12mV保存为gaming_profile配置文件游戏前加载该配置文件优化后游戏帧率提升了12%且连续游戏3小时无崩溃。场景二解决系统启动失败问题问题场景电脑无法正常启动按下电源键后电脑卡在主板LOGO界面无法进入系统。重启、重置BIOS都无效这通常是SMU固件状态异常导致的。核心原理SMU固件与启动流程SMU系统管理单元是Ryzen处理器的大脑负责协调所有硬件组件。如果SMU固件损坏或配置错误系统就无法正常启动。解决方案SMU固件恢复操作目的具体步骤预期结果常见问题创建恢复盘1. 准备USB盘2. 复制SMUDebugTool到根目录USB盘可启动确保U盘格式化为FAT32进入恢复模式1. 设置USB为第一启动项2. 从USB启动进入SMUDebugTool界面可能需要关闭安全启动诊断问题1. 运行SMU状态检查2. 查看错误日志显示具体错误代码记录错误信息执行恢复1. 选择固件恢复选项2. 等待完成显示恢复成功过程约30-60秒重启系统1. 移除USB盘2. 正常启动系统正常进入桌面可能需要重新配置BIOS成功90%的启动问题可以通过基本固件重置解决无需送修或更换硬件。进阶技巧创建系统恢复点在进行任何重要操作前务必创建系统恢复点# 备份当前SMU配置 SMUDebugTool.exe --backup-smu-config # 备份BIOS设置 SMUDebugTool.exe --backup-bios-settings # 创建完整系统快照 SMUDebugTool.exe --create-system-snapshot场景三优化多任务处理性能问题场景多程序同时运行卡顿同时运行视频编辑、浏览器和办公软件时系统响应变慢任务切换卡顿。这通常是NUMA节点内存访问不均衡导致的。核心原理NUMA架构与内存分配Ryzen处理器采用NUMA非统一内存访问架构每个核心组有本地内存。当程序跨节点访问内存时会产生额外延迟。解决方案NUMA节点优化优化步骤操作指南性能提升适用场景1. 分析NUMA布局查看系统NUMA节点分布了解内存拓扑所有多核系统2. 绑定应用程序将程序绑定到特定节点减少内存延迟视频编辑、3D渲染3. 优化内存分配调整程序内存使用策略提升缓存命中率数据库、虚拟机4. 监控效果实时监控内存访问延迟验证优化效果性能调优提示使用NUMA_MONITOR 进程ID命令可以实时监控应用程序的内存访问模式找到最优绑定策略。高级功能与进阶技巧PCI设备深度调试SMUDebugTool不仅可以调试CPU还能访问PCI设备的配置空间# 查看所有PCI设备 SMUDebugTool.exe --pci-scan # 读取特定设备配置 SMUDebugTool.exe --pci-read 设备ID # 修改PCI设备参数 SMUDebugTool.exe --pci-write 设备ID 参数MSR寄存器访问MSR模型特定寄存器包含CPU的核心控制参数# 备份所有MSR寄存器 SMUDebugTool.exe --msr-backup-all # 应用优化配置 SMUDebugTool.exe --msr-apply-profile performance.msr # 恢复原始设置 SMUDebugTool.exe --msr-restore-backup警告MSR寄存器修改有风险仅建议高级用户在充分了解的情况下操作。自动化脚本编写对于重复性任务可以编写批处理脚本echo off REM 启动SMUDebugTool并应用游戏配置 SMUDebugTool.exe --load-profile gaming.cfg SMUDebugTool.exe --set-voltage 0-71.185 8-151.190 SMUDebugTool.exe --enable-pbo echo 系统优化完成可以开始游戏安装与快速开始指南系统要求组件最低要求推荐配置操作系统Windows 10 64位Windows 11 64位处理器AMD Ryzen 3000系列AMD Ryzen 5000系列内存8GB RAM16GB RAM或更多权限管理员权限管理员权限.NET框架4.7.24.8或更高安装步骤获取工具git clone https://gitcode.com/gh_mirrors/smu/SMUDebugTool cd SMUDebugTool运行兼容性检查SMUDebugTool.exe --check-compatibility完成初始配置以管理员身份运行工具完成设置向导创建系统备份开始使用浏览各个功能模块尝试运行系统诊断创建第一个优化配置文件首次使用建议先从Info标签页开始了解系统硬件信息使用Diagnose功能进行系统健康检查创建default_backup配置文件熟悉界面布局和主要功能区域最佳实践与注意事项安全操作规范备份先行在进行任何修改前务必创建系统备份小步调整每次只调整一个参数观察系统反应充分测试每个调整后至少运行30分钟压力测试记录日志详细记录每次修改的参数和效果常见问题解决问题现象可能原因解决方案工具无法启动权限不足以管理员身份运行无法读取硬件驱动问题更新芯片组驱动修改无效安全设置关闭安全启动系统不稳定参数过激恢复默认设置性能优化建议游戏场景优先优化单核性能调整PBO曲线创作场景优化多核性能平衡电压与温度服务器场景注重稳定性使用保守参数日常使用启用节能模式延长硬件寿命总结与下一步行动SMUDebugTool为Ryzen用户打开了一扇通往硬件底层的大门。通过本文的指南你已经掌握了✅ 解决系统启动问题的SMU固件恢复技巧✅ 优化游戏性能的核心电压调整方法✅ 提升多任务处理的NUMA节点绑定策略✅ 使用高级功能的自动化脚本编写下一步行动建议立即尝试下载SMUDebugTool运行系统诊断功能创建备份在进行任何修改前创建完整的系统备份从小开始先尝试调整一个核心的电压观察效果加入社区分享你的使用经验学习他人的优化技巧记住硬件调试需要耐心和谨慎。每次成功的优化都是对系统理解的深化每次问题的解决都是技术能力的提升。现在拿起SMUDebugTool开始你的Ryzen系统优化之旅吧【免费下载链接】SMUDebugToolA dedicated tool to help write/read various parameters of Ryzen-based systems, such as manual overclock, SMU, PCI, CPUID, MSR and Power Table.项目地址: https://gitcode.com/gh_mirrors/smu/SMUDebugTool创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

更多文章